Under the Pretext of Jewish Holidays, the Ibrahimi Mosque Was Closed and Prayers Were Prohibited There.

Summary by Al Bawaba
Palestinian media reported that Israeli occupation forces closed the Ibrahimi Mosque in Hebron, in the southern West Bank, on Wednesday, preventing worshippers from accessing it, according to a statement issued by the Hebron Waqf Directorate.

Hamas described Israel's closure of the Ibrahimi Mosque in the West Bank as an "attack on sanctity," calling on Palestinians to protect holy sites and urging the Islamic world to intervene urgently.
